What I did to prepare for my hysterectomy on 2/26213 ,
I started by preparing a list of everything I need to do inorder to leave my home functional without me for 8 weeks. Then checked it off after the task was completed.
~ I prepaid all my bills .
~During the month of February I prepared double portioned dinner meals and froze the leftovers . This would make it easier for my husband. Reheat and serve to our family of 4.
~ cleaned out and rearanged the pantry, fridge and freezer .
~shop for quick fixing meals breakfast, lunch , and dinner. Stock up on dry goods.
~shop and stock the closet with hygiene products, cleaning chemicals, dog food, paper products.
Bank~ withdraw small bills and made a petty cash envelope for the home. Kids always need a dollar or two for something.
Detailed list of instruction for basic things I usually do.
~ advised the schools of my surgery and add people to the emergency contact list.
~ I tried to excersise any chance I could get. I wanted to strengthen my muscles as much as possible.
~ maintain a nutritious diet . You can never have enough healthy nutrients in your diet.
~ made arrangements with family members to come over and help with the kids so it wasn't all on my husbands shoulders.
Did all the laundry and cleaned the house. I didn't want to come home to a mess. And this would put my mind at ease with all the different visitors.
~ Updaed my living will as well as rechecked the will in the event of an unforeseen emergency.
~ packed a suitcase
~Fueled up the vehicles.
Made sure all of the vehicles were up to date on their required maintenance .
~ made sure the kids had everything they needed. Hair cuts, meds, dr apts.
~cut and bathed the dogs.
Hubby detail cleaned the walls, floor and bathrooms. Making our home a sterile healing environment .
~ forwarded my PO Box mail temporarily until I'm able to drive again comfortly. (I gave myself 4 weeks.)
~ Had all the carpets professionally cleaned.
~ made a list of people with their phone numbers and handed that to my son. He was in charge of letting a few people know how I made out after my surgery.
~ I put a emergency sheet on my fridge containing our address, physicians names numbers and addresses, local relative name numbers
~ rescheduled and postponed some of my regular appointments.
~ made sure I had enough of my regular daily meds.
~ gathered and made a separate section in my closet with loose fitting clothing.
~ rearranged some of my things to a location that will be easily accessable after surgery
